Comparing Hand Gestures: Booker vs. Musk

  • 💡 The discussion centers on whether Senator Cory Booker made a "Nazi salute" while thanking supporters, drawing parallels to past accusations against Elon Musk.
  • 🎯 The speaker argues that if Elon Musk's gesture was interpreted as a Nazi salute, then Booker's similar gesture should be viewed through the same lens, highlighting a perceived double standard.
  • 🔍 While the speaker believes neither Booker nor Musk intended a Nazi salute, they note the discrepancy in media coverage and outrage.

Media Bias and Political Discourse

  • ⚠️ The presenter contends that mainstream media exhibits hopeless bias, excusing actions by Democrats that would be heavily criticized if performed by Republicans.
  • 🗣️ The conversation touches on how terms like "Nazi," "fascist," and "Hitler" are frequently used in political discourse, potentially cheapening the historical significance of the Holocaust.
  • ⚖️ There's a call for consistency in outrage across the political spectrum, suggesting that accusations should be applied equally regardless of political affiliation.

Social Media Echo Chambers and Misinterpretation

  • 📱 Social media is identified as a platform that facilitates ideological self-reinforcement and echo chambers, where individuals can find information to support their pre-existing beliefs.
  • 🧠 The phenomenon of misinterpreting gestures, like the "okay hand sign" or the gestures in question, is discussed, suggesting that people may project ill intent where none exists, sometimes referred to as "Lord Voldemort" language.
  • 🧐 The media's role in amplifying these interpretations and contributing to mistrust is also examined, with a suggestion that some iconography can be misinterpreted.

The Nuance of Political Language

  • 🚫 It's argued that conceding ground on gestures like raising a hand to supporters as inherently Nazi is absurd and that the Holocaust should not be used as a metaphor for political points.
  • 🌐 The current political landscape is characterized by unvetted voices and chaotic discourse on social media, where both mainstream and fringe figures can be accused of conspiracy theories or hateful ideologies.
  • ✅ A desire for real journalism and more thoughtful conversations is expressed, distinguishing between genuine appreciation for supporters and the escalation of accusations.
